Astrobiology is the multi-disciplinary box dedicated to the research of the starting place; actual, chemical and environmental obstacles; and the distribution in area and time of existence on the earth and within the Cosmos. Astrobiology seeks a solution to 1 of the main primary of all questions: Is existence limited to Planet Earth or is existence a Cosmic primary? knowing the features, houses, conduct, and variety of dwelling organisms in the world is important to figure out the place and the way to look for facts of existence in other places. New ideas and methodologies needs to be constructed so as to ascertain an appropriate suite of legitimate biomarkers that's had to facilitate the differentiation of abiotic procedures from real signatures of lifestyles. this is often the most important to set up the standards had to appropriately overview power biosignatures in old Earth rocks and in a wide selection of Astromaterials. What Are Gamma-Ray Bursts

Gamma-ray bursts are the brightest--and, till lately, one of the least understood--cosmic occasions within the universe. found by accident through the chilly conflict, those evanescent high-energy explosions confounded astronomers for many years. yet a fast sequence of startling breakthroughs starting in 1997 published that almost all of gamma-ray bursts are brought on by the explosions of younger and big stars within the monstrous star-forming cauldrons of far away galaxies.

Calculating Space

Calculating area is the name of MIT's English translation of Konrad Zuse's 1969 e-book Rechnender Raum (literally: "space that's computing"), the 1st booklet on electronic physics. [1]

Zuse proposed that the universe is being computed by way of a few kind of mobile automaton or different discrete computing machinery,[1] tough the long-held view that a few actual legislation are non-stop through nature. He interested by mobile automata as a potential substrate of the computation, and mentioned (among different issues) that the classical notions of entropy and its progress are not making feel in deterministically computed universes.
